Street Paving in Little Rock, AR
Street paving services involve the installation, repair, and resurfacing of asphalt or concrete surfaces used for driveways, parking lots, walkways, and residential streets. These projects typically include preparing the existing surface, laying new pavement, and ensuring proper compaction and finishing to create a smooth, durable surface. Property owners often request street paving to improve curb appeal, ensure safe access, and enhance the functionality of their outdoor spaces, whether for residential driveways or commercial parking areas.
Before requesting street paving services, property owners should consider factors such as the size and scope of the project, existing surface conditions, and desired materials. It’s also helpful to understand any necessary permits or regulations in Little Rock, AR, and nearby areas. Clarifying the intended use of the paved surface and any specific aesthetic or durability requirements can help ensure the project meets expectations and provides long-lasting results.

Common Street Paving Jobs
Residential street paving - improves driveway and street surfaces for better durability and appearance.
Asphalt repair and resurfacing - restores damaged or worn pavement to extend its lifespan.
Parking lot paving - creates smooth, safe surfaces for commercial and residential parking areas.
Driveway paving - enhances curb appeal and functionality with new or replacement asphalt surfaces.
Pothole patching - quickly addresses small cracks and holes to prevent further pavement deterioration.
Sealcoating services - protects paved surfaces from weather damage and extends their service life.
Street Paving Questions
What types of surfaces can be paved? Asphalt and concrete are common surfaces for paving residential driveways, walkways, and parking areas.
Is street paving suitable for driveways? Yes, street paving can improve the durability and appearance of residential driveways and access roads.
What should property owners consider before paving? It's important to assess the current surface condition and drainage needs to ensure a long-lasting result.
Can paving be done on existing surfaces? Yes, paving can often be applied over existing surfaces to enhance stability and appearance.
